Advertisement

基于Android与JSP/PHP及MySQL的微博应用程序开发

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目旨在开发一款运行于Android平台并与Web端无缝对接的微博应用。采用JSP/PHP技术进行服务器端编程,并利用MySQL数据库存储数据,实现用户间的信息交流和分享功能。 开发一个微博客户端及Web服务器的项目可以包括以下内容: 1. 使用Android技术来构建微博客户端。 2. 利用JSP或PHP语言搭建微博网站服务端。 3. 采用MySQL数据库作为Web服务器的数据存储解决方案。 4. 实现发布、查看和浏览微博列表等核心功能。 5. 提供用户发表评论的功能,增强互动性。 6. 设计并实现客户端登录机制。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• AndroidJSP/PHPMySQL
    优质
    本项目旨在开发一款运行于Android平台并与Web端无缝对接的微博应用。采用JSP/PHP技术进行服务器端编程,并利用MySQL数据库存储数据,实现用户间的信息交流和分享功能。 开发一个微博客户端及Web服务器的项目可以包括以下内容: 1. 使用Android技术来构建微博客户端。 2. 利用JSP或PHP语言搭建微博网站服务端。 3. 采用MySQL数据库作为Web服务器的数据存储解决方案。 4. 实现发布、查看和浏览微博列表等核心功能。 5. 提供用户发表评论的功能,增强互动性。 6. 设计并实现客户端登录机制。
  • AndroidWebMySQL设计
    优质
    本项目旨在设计并实现一款集Android应用和网页端于一体的微博平台,数据存储采用MySQL数据库。用户可跨终端便捷地进行社交互动。 使用Android + JSP(或PHP)+ MySQL编程开发微博应用: 1. 使用Android技术开发微博客户端; 2. 采用JSP或PHP构建微博Web服务器; 3. 利用MySQL作为Web服务器的后台数据库; 4. 实现发布、查看和浏览微博的功能; 5. 支持发表评论功能; 6. 提供用户登录客户端的服务。
  • PHPMySQL客系统
    优质
    这是一款采用PHP语言结合MySQL数据库技术构建的轻量级博客平台,旨在为用户提供简洁高效的个人日志发布与分享服务。 基于PHP+MySQL开发的轻博客系统采用国际成熟的Smarty标签引擎构建标签系统,旨在为用户提供一个简洁且功能齐全的学习平台。尽管程序规模较小,但涵盖了大部分应用技术,例如图片上传裁切、百度Ueditor编辑器使用以及Smarty自定义块和函数的应用等。如果您对PHP有一定的基础了解,本轻博客系统将帮助您进一步提升技能水平。
  • Java信校园文库小MySQL数据库
    优质
    本项目基于Java语言开发,旨在创建一个适用于微信平台的校园文库小程序,并利用MySQL数据库进行数据管理与存储。 使用HBuilder X开发微信小程序,并利用Java后端开发工具IDEA配合MySQL数据库进行项目构建。主要功能包括用户管理、文档资料浏览与编辑、收藏列表维护、下载管理和系统设置,同时支持权限分配等功能。
  • PHPMySQL简单系统
    优质
    本项目是一款基于PHP与MySQL技术构建的简易微博平台,用户可以发布、评论及分享动态,实现基本的社交功能。 基于PHP和MySQL数据库的简易微博系统。
  • AndroidMySQL美食【100011046】
    优质
    本项目是一款基于Android平台与MySQL数据库技术打造的美食应用(代码100011046),旨在为用户提供便捷、个性化的餐饮选择服务。 本项目旨在适应市场需求,方便顾客快速找到优质的餐饮服务,并提供详细的菜品信息浏览功能。为此,我们计划开发一款大众美食点评APP,该应用将满足用户对食品搜索、食品评价及店铺查找的需求。 为了实现便捷的餐饮评论和搜索功能,系统需要具备以下核心操作:菜品分类浏览、菜品详细信息展示、菜品评分体系以及个人中心等功能。具体描述如下: 1. **菜品信息分类浏览**: 在APP的“发现”栏目中,所有菜品按照菜系进行分类显示。该界面仅提供概览图、名称和所属菜系。 2. **主页推荐**: APP首页每天会自动展示热门或推荐菜品,用户可以点击感兴趣的菜品进入详细页面查看相关信息。 3. **菜品详情页**: 为每道菜品提供了详细的介绍页面,包括评分、来源商家信息(口味描述、价格)、地址及简介,并且支持收藏功能让用户保存自己喜欢的菜式。 4. **评价体系**: 用户可以对每个菜品进行星级评分和撰写评论。评分为五级制,同时也会计算所有用户的平均分来给出具体的分数评价;此外还允许用户发表详细的个人体验反馈。 5. **登录与注册模块**: 使用APP的大部分功能都需要先完成账号登录或创建新账户才能使用。
  • Android
    优质
    简介:本课程旨在教授学生如何使用Java或Kotlin语言在Android平台上创建高效、用户友好的移动应用。从界面设计到后台逻辑实现,全面覆盖Android开发的基础知识与实践技巧。 Android应用开发是移动设备软件领域的一个重要分支,主要针对谷歌的Android操作系统。这个平台为开发者提供了丰富的功能和工具,使他们能够创建各种各样的应用程序,包括游戏、社交媒体应用以及生产力工具等。 对于零基础学习者来说,了解以下几个关键知识点至关重要: 1. **环境搭建**:你需要安装Android Studio——这是Google官方提供的集成开发环境(IDE)。它包含了开发、调试及发布Android应用所需的所有工具。在安装之后,你还需要配置Android SDK,并选择所需的API级别和平台。 2. **编程语言**:起初,大多数Android应用使用Java进行编写;然而,随着Kotlin被确立为官方推荐的编程语言,学习Kotlin成为首选路径。这两种语言的基本语法与特性对于开发高质量的应用程序至关重要。 3. **清单文件(AndroidManifest.xml)**:每个应用程序都必须包含一个清单文件来定义其基本属性、所需的权限及应用组件等信息(如活动、服务和广播接收器)及其生命周期管理方式。 4. **Activity处理**:在Android中,用户界面的基本单元是“Activity”,它代表了屏幕上的一个视图。掌握如何创建与管理这些元素,并理解它们之间的跳转机制对于开发工作来说至关重要。 5. **布局设计**:通过XML文件来定义应用的视觉外观和用户体验是非常重要的一步。熟悉不同的布局类型(例如线性、相对或约束布局)及其使用方法,有助于构建出既美观又响应迅速的应用界面。 6. **Intent概念**:在Android中,“intent”用于启动新的Activity或者与其它组件进行通信。“意图”的另一重要用途是传递数据和消息。 7. **资源管理**:应用可以利用多种类型的资源(如图片、字符串及颜色值等),这些可以通过特定的ID引用,便于实现国际化以及动态调整设置。 8. **生命周期理解**:了解每个组件(例如Activity和服务)的生命阶段,并知道何时保存状态或恢复它对于防止应用程序崩溃来说是至关重要的知识领域。 9. **Fragment应用**:片段允许在多个活动中复用UI元素。它们特别适合于大屏幕设备和平板电脑,能够创建更加灵活的布局设计。 10. **异步处理技术**:Android中的许多任务需要后台执行(如网络请求或数据库操作)。AsyncTask、Handler、Runnable及IntentService等机制都是管理此类工作的有效方法;对于Kotlin开发者而言,则可以考虑使用Coroutines这一新工具来简化代码逻辑并提高效率。 11. **数据存储方案**:为了保存用户信息或其他重要数据,Android提供了多种选项(包括SQLite数据库和SharedPreferences),同时也可以利用内部或外部存储空间以及云端API进行扩展性开发工作。 12. **通知与消息传递机制**:通过Notification API可以向用户发送即时提醒。掌握如何创建及管理这些通知是提升用户体验的关键要素之一。 13. **权限控制策略**:从Android 6.0开始,系统引入了运行时权限请求机制,使得开发者能够更安全地访问敏感信息和服务功能。 14. **测试框架应用**:确保软件质量的重要步骤包括编写单元和UI自动化测试。JUnit及Espresso就是执行此类任务的常用工具选项之一。 15. **Gradle构建流程理解**:Android Studio默认采用Gradle作为其构建系统,因此掌握基本概念以及如何配置build.gradle文件对于项目管理和打包来说是必要的技能点。 通过深入学习上述知识点并结合《Android应用程序开发教程》中的示例练习,你将能够逐步掌握Android应用开发,并有能力创建出自己的独特作品。务必重视理论与实践相结合的重要性,在不断实践中优化和完善你的代码编写技巧和设计思路。
  • Android Studio笔记.rar
    优质
    这是一个基于Android Studio开发的笔记应用项目文件,用户可以利用该应用方便地创建、编辑和管理个人笔记。 源码参考,亲测有效,欢迎下载。
  • Android Studio记账.zip
    优质
    本项目是一款基于Android Studio开发的个人财务管理应用,旨在帮助用户轻松记录日常收支情况,实现智能化财务规划与分析。 项目工程资源需经过严格测试并确保功能正常后才会上传。这些资源可以轻松复制复刻,并且包含完整源码、工程文件及必要的说明文档(如有)。本人拥有丰富的系统开发经验,涵盖全栈开发领域,欢迎随时提出使用问题,我会及时提供帮助和解答。 【资源内容】:项目具体内容可在下方查看“资源详情”,包括完整的源代码与工程文件以及相关说明。如非VIP用户,请通过平台私信获取此资源。 【本人专注IT领域】:对于任何关于使用的疑问或技术上的支持需求,欢迎随时联系我,我会尽快给予帮助。 【附带服务】:如果需要相关的开发工具、学习资料等额外的支持,我也愿意提供协助和推荐有用的参考资料以促进您的进步和发展。 【适用场景】:这些资源适用于各种项目设计阶段的应用,包括但不限于实际项目的开发工作、毕业设计任务、课程作业与实验操作、学科竞赛准备以及初期的项目立项规划等方面。您不仅可以参考并复刻这个优质项目,还可以在此基础上进行功能扩展和创新性研发。 请仅将本资源用于开源学习和技术交流目的,严禁任何形式的商业用途使用,并且使用者须自行承担由此产生的任何后果。 涉及版权问题或内容侵权时,请联系我处理相关事宜。收取的费用仅为整理收集资料所花费时间的价值补偿,不包含法律责任。
  • PHPMySQLAndroid后台
    优质
    本文章介绍了如何利用PHP和MySQL技术搭建Android应用的后端服务,包括数据交互、服务器配置等内容。适合开发者学习参考。 PHP作为后台用于操作MySQL数据库,Android作为前端可以执行对数据库的增、删、改、查等基本操作。附件中的代码适用于与我上传的PHP服务器代码配合使用。